Florida football betting odds for the Gators had this with a total regular season wins of OVER/UNDER 8.5.  The OVER was priced at -130 and the UNDER +110.  

BetOnline

Expert predictions for Florida have this team winning 9 or 10 games easily with the biggest challenges occurring on 10/12 at LSU and 11/16 at South Carolina.  Few of the experts believe Florida can overcome either team on the road.  But, still, that OVER is worth the price at -130.  Season win totals betting for College Football is only available until the morning of August 31.

Braden Gall of AthlonSports.com writes:

The Gators' offense will be much improved in 2013 and it should be on full display in an early non-conference test with Miami in South Florida. Should it win in Miami, Florida will be 5-0 heading into Baton Rouge to battle LSU in what could be a top 10 match-up. Should it handle it's business against teams like Florida State, Missouri and Vanderbilt in the second half, Will Muschamp will be starring directly at another 10-win season. Bouts with Georgia and South Carolina loom large in the first three weeks of November and a split either way would give the Gators a shot at a trip to Atlanta.

83 percent of those betting the total regular season wins for Florida in 2013 are backing the OVER.
